From: Stefan Monnier
Subject: [elpa] master ec41ab4: * nhexl-mode/nhexl-mode.el: Let isearch look for addresses as well
Date: Thu, 19 Apr 2018 13:28:52 -0400 (EDT)

branch: master
commit ec41ab4bd73dcb914bb7495d2e1eaf908f8a263d
Author: Stefan Monnier <address@hidden>
Commit: Stefan Monnier <address@hidden>

    * nhexl-mode/nhexl-mode.el: Let isearch look for addresses as well
    
    (nhexl-obey-font-lock): New custom var.
    (nhexl--make-line, nhexl--jit): Use it.
    (nhexl-silently-convert-to-unibyte): New custom var.
    (nhexl-mode): Use it.  Set isearch-search-fun-function.
    Don't bother switching to unibyte for pure-ascii buffers.
    Be more robust for the case when nhexl-mode is enabled while it was
    already enabled.
    (nhexl--isearch-search-fun): New function.
    (nhexl--font-lock-switch): New function.
